Mouse.HoverImplementation Method
Pauses the mouse at the specified location that is relative to the specified control for a specified duration.
Namespace: Microsoft.VisualStudio.TestTools.UITesting
Assembly: Microsoft.VisualStudio.TestTools.UITesting (in Microsoft.VisualStudio.TestTools.UITesting.dll)
Syntax
'Declaration
Protected Overridable Sub HoverImplementation ( _
control As UITestControl, _
relativeCoordinate As Point, _
millisecondsDuration As Integer _
)
protected virtual void HoverImplementation(
UITestControl control,
Point relativeCoordinate,
int millisecondsDuration
)
protected:
virtual void HoverImplementation(
UITestControl^ control,
Point relativeCoordinate,
int millisecondsDuration
)
abstract HoverImplementation :
control:UITestControl *
relativeCoordinate:Point *
millisecondsDuration:int -> unit
override HoverImplementation :
control:UITestControl *
relativeCoordinate:Point *
millisecondsDuration:int -> unit
protected function HoverImplementation(
control : UITestControl,
relativeCoordinate : Point,
millisecondsDuration : int
)
Parameters
- control
Type: Microsoft.VisualStudio.TestTools.UITesting.UITestControl
UITestControl to which the mouse is to be hovered.
- relativeCoordinate
Type: System.Drawing.Point
Point that is relative to the control to which to move the mouse. If control is nulla null reference (Nothing in Visual Basic), the relativeCoordinate specifies an absolute coordinate.
- millisecondsDuration
Type: System.Int32
Duration of the mouse hover.
.NET Framework Security
- Full trust for the immediate caller. This member cannot be used by partially trusted code. For more information, see Using Libraries from Partially Trusted Code.